Output 175294a9957c515777a5fa0584823a6836f90f8d7971b0a43d5faf278b6364af:7

value
11803659
script pubkey
OP_HASH160 OP_PUSHBYTES_20 883beff20d6ed329645266005fb91929b124a00e OP_EQUAL
address
MLKVw2yUjattFBoyGV8VeLPCkjZRf6TPd1
transaction
175294a9957c515777a5fa0584823a6836f90f8d7971b0a43d5faf278b6364af
spent
true